A burglar with a big appetite carried out a bizarre break-in at the Sexy Salad restaurant in Hauppauge early Saturday morning.
The owner tells News 12 that based on surveillance video of the incident at his Adams Road eatery, he believes the suspect was drunk and hungry.
"If you're gonna be broken into, you might as well get a good laugh out of it. This guy was hysterical -- I've never seen somebody so drunk and appreciative of bananas," the owner says. "I think we counted up 11 bananas. I think there were nine or 10 bags of potato chips. I don't know how many raspberry bars, pecan bars and muffins he ate."
Police say the suspect also urinated into a garbage can and took a nap on the floor before leaving the eatery. He left a New York State driver license and a watch at the scene.
Officials say the man featured in the surveillance video has made restitution to the business owner and the owner is no longer pursuing charges against him.
